Pass percentages go up across all categories in Chennai schools

Chennai: Schools in Chennai district, cutting across categories, have marginally improved their performance in the 2025-26 academic year. Data shared by the chief education office showed that schools run by the education department recorded a 89.94 pass percentage for 2025-26, with 7,771 of 8,649 students passing the exam — a jump from 87.43% recorded in the previous academic year.A total of 4,778 of 5,179 corporation school students passed, recording a 92.26 pass percentage, up from 88.12% recorded in 2024-25. As for adi dravidar schools, 310 out of 376 students passed the test, with a pass percentage of 82.4 — up from 82.14% recorded last year.Further, aided schools logged a pass percentage of 94.8 and private schools, 98%. “We jumped from 23rd rank to 20th in the overall pass percentage and from mid-30s to 29 in the performance of govt schools (corporation, adi ravidar and schools run by the education department). As many as 170 out of 578 schools recorded a 100% pass, and five of them were govt schools,” chief education officer M Kabir said.A total of 270 students scored centum in maths, history, biology, physics, chemistry, commerce, accountancy and economics. Of them, 195 were from aided schools and 75 from govt schools. Overall, the district recorded a pass percentage of 95.43 this year.Parents and teachers welcomed the improvement, but said there is a long way to go. “There are still several districts ahead of us, despite Chennai having all the infrastructural facilities and resource centres. Even Ramanathapuram is ahead of us (rank 12). We should ideally find a place in the top five, but that hasn’t happened in the last decade. There is a need for periodic review and a complete re-haul of the educational approach to improve in rankings,” said S Arumainathan, president, TN Students Parents Welfare Association.
